You might want to try the lrp SPX reversible. It has a low turn limit and has reverse if you want to set it up. (good for practice).
I like the idea behind the new Novak Ballistic motors that have an interchangeable stator. You could buy a 13.5 and just buy the stator for other turns and run different classes cheaper than buying another motor.
